🏒 Today we’re thinking of Pittsburgh Penguins forward Filip Hallander, who was recently diagnosed with a blood clot in his leg and is expected to be sidelined for at least three months. Although pro athletes are often young and healthy, the physical demands of sports can raise clot risk: • Dehydration from intense training • Injuries or surgeries that limit movement • Long travel to games or events • Repetitive motions that compress veins (like pitching or cycling) Knowing the signs, including
